+ -
当前位置:首页 → 问答吧 → 关于crontab和shell文件,江湖救急,分有点少..HELP ME..

关于crontab和shell文件,江湖救急,分有点少..HELP ME..

时间:2011-10-25

来源:互联网


1.* * * * * root sh /home/test (这种格式貌似是错误的,因为多了一个root) 
 
 貌似这样也是错误的(* * * * * root /home/test)

 请问下,如果我要加上一个用户...需要怎么写?


2.
 [root@shell]# a2=56789
 [root@shell]# echo $a2
 56789
 这样可以得到a2的值,因为a2为shell变量

 但是.我在一个文件为t1的里面写上
 # t1文件内容##
 #! /bin/bash
 echo $a2
 ############

 保存文件.

 执行[root@shell]# sh t1 
 
 返回为空..请问这是为什么...

ps:说明一下,我的理解
  a2定义的是shell变量..因为用set可以得到a2的值 所以用echo $a2可以得到值,这个可以理解
  但是.我把它写到一个文件里面.并且也指定了/bin/bash..就是说.这个文件会用到shell变量.
  那么$a2是shell变量.就应该有这个值出来.但却为什么没有呢?
 

作者: m582445672   发布时间: 2011-10-25

#a2=56789

#cat test.sh
echo $a2

#. ./test.sh
56789

作者: ljc007   发布时间: 2011-10-25

相关阅读 更多